    Yeah, that's why I got them. They were just an effing arm. The bushings were OEM and the BJ was a bog standard easy to source and replace BJ. So if JBA never made another one I didn't care as parts that might need replacing could be sourced from anywhere. And since poor Nick wrenched for multiple weekends debugging the design I knew it was solid ;)

    Yeah, so is this now the default thing he ships with? Or did you have to "upgrade" to this? I also see he has a JBA ball joint of some kind. Yours come with that or a standard 3rd party part?

    I have to say, if it is now poly bushings and a non-standard ball joint I kind of fail to see the point...

    WRT the ball joint, you should still be able to swap in the readily available predecessor Moog part. The pattern is the same. Apparently the new elastomer bushings also fit TC UCAs, so I guess they are not totally one-off.

    But in your unusual usage scenario, yeah, the OEM/Moog setup would make sense if something broke in Bilgewater, CA, and you needed parts like now.

    My set did not include the special pin-spanner tool to disassemble the top cap for rebuilding. I asked about this, and he said you need to buy a rebuild kit. I asked if he could provide a source for that, because there is none provided on his website. I did not get an answer to that specific question. So I wasn't thrilled with that.
